Reusing photovoltaic panels has some major advantages. For starters, it helps reduce the quantity of waste that is being sent out to landfills or incinerators. Not only does this benefit the atmosphere by reducing air pollution, yet it can also conserve cash in disposal costs as well as beneficial resources such as metals or glass. Furthermore, reusing solar panels permits materials that were when thought about pointless to be repurposed right into new products. Recycled products can also be used to generate more economical versions of new photovoltaic panels, making them a lot more obtainable for individuals who might not have actually had the ability to afford them before.
The downside of recycling photovoltaic panels is that there is commonly a lack of framework in place for properly disposing of old ones. In some cases, this implies that harmful products are released into the atmosphere during manufacturing or disassembly processes which could create wellness dangers for those living close by. Additionally, recyclers may not always be able to recuperate all parts from taken apart panels because of their age or condition which can lead to more ecological issues because of improper disposal methods.

One of the greatest issues with recycling photovoltaic panels is the intricacy of the task itself. It can be tough to break down the various components, such as glass and steel, to be reused individually. Furthermore, solar panel producers usually have a mix of products made use of in their products that makes arranging them much more difficult. An additional essential challenge related to reusing solar panels is expense. Numerous nations do not have sufficient infrastructure or sources to adequately reuse these things which leads to higher expenditures for companies trying to do so. In addition, because of the specialized nature of recycling solar panels, this can develop a financial problem on companies trying to remain compliant with policies. Inevitably, these costs could be passed down to consumers making it tough for them to pay for renewable energy sources.

To start with, several companies have actually implemented a 'take-back' system where old or broken photovoltaic panels can be gathered and sent out to their respective manufacturing facilities for reusing. In this manner, the products are able to be recycled in the building of brand-new products. In addition, some towns have actually even started providing rewards for individuals desiring to reuse their solar panels; this might range from tax obligation breaks to cost-free shipping expenses.
Furthermore, innovation has become progressively sophisticated when it comes to recycling photovoltaic panels-- with specialized devices efficient in separating out all the various components within them. For example, by utilizing AI-powered robotic arms, these makers can extract beneficial materials such as copper and aluminium while also throwing away contaminated materials safely.
